The sum of the weights of an iron piece and of a copper piece is 1280 g. The volume of the copper piece is twice that of the iron piece. If the weight of 1 cu.cm of iron is 7.8 g and that copper is 8.9 g, find the volume of each piece.

Step-by-step explanation:

Let the amount of iron piece be x

Amount of Copper piece=2x

Density of iron=7.8g/cc

Density of copper=8.9g/cc

Weight of iron=7.8x

Weight of copper=17.8x

Total weight=1280g

7.8x+17.8x=1280

25.6x=1280

x=50

Weight of iron=7.8×50=390g

Weight of copper=890g

Volume of iron=390/7.8=50ml

Volume of copper=890/8.9=100ml
